Post by OAA on May 23, 2013 19:25:46 GMT
The annual slalom event organised by Bridgend Canoe Club has been confirmed by the Committee and will take place on 29th and 30th June near the Recreation Centre.
In addition to this the Royal Air Force Cadets have been given permission to use this section of the river on the evening of the 17th June to practice for the above event.
The South Wales Fire and Rescue Service often carry out exercises underneath the M4 near Pen y Fai. The dates that they wish to use the river at this location are now being given to the Association to agree. To this end, the Committee have agreed that they can use the river for a training exercise on 19th August.
